Gain a comprehensive understanding of cybersecurity and information technology through the cross-disciplinary Bachelor of Science in Applied Cybersecurity and Information Technology. Learn how cybersecurity, technology, management, compliance, and legal issues intersect through this well-rounded program. Experienced information technology professionals and those new to the field can prepare to become cybersecurity and information technology practitioners, investigators, managers, and leaders in one of the fastest growing job sectors. Additional mathematical skills prepare for research and entry into the Master of Science in Applied Cybersecurity and Digital Forensics program.
Study information security, information assurance, ethical hacking, vulnerability analysis and control, securing databases, steganography, mobile device forensics, operating system security, business continuity response, disaster recovery, legal and ethical issues, auditing, evidence, and intrusion detection. Work with forensic tools and techniques used to investigate and analyze network-related incidents and preserve digital evidence.
